New Wheels today - always liked the look of swamper wheels - but didn't want to go for a full swamper on the van - lift kit e.t.c. T6 Highline lowered 40mm with Oz Rally Raids in Matt black with 235/60/17r General Grabbers AT3 - rides lovely and not so concerned about the terrible Devon roads anymore! Slightly un conventional wheels/tyre combo on a lowered van but really pleased with how well they fill the arches and look, no rubbing but very snug, excellent next day delivery package from 'Elite Wheels', highly recommend those guys - very helpful.
